DF15005S thru DF1510S
FEATURES
Rating to 1000V PRV
Ideal for printed circuit board
Low forward voltage drop, high current capability.
Reliable low cost construction utilizing molded plastic
technique results in inexp ensiv e product
The plastic material has UL flammability classification
94V-0
UL recognized file # E95060
MECHANICAL DATA
Polarity : As marked on Body
Weight : 0.02 ounces, 0 .38 gr ams
Mounting positio n : Any
MAXIM UM RATINGS AND ELECTRICAL CHARACTERISTICS
Ratings at 25
ambient temperature unless otherwise specified.
Single phase, half wave, 60Hz, resistive or inductive load.
For capacitive load, derate current by 20%
